Szeged vs Balmaceda Puerto Climate & Distance Between

Chile flag
  • The distance between Szeged, Hungary and Balmaceda Puerto, Chile is approximately 13,596 km or 8,449 mi.
  • To reach Szeged in this distance one would set out from Balmaceda Puerto bearing 54.8°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Szeged bearing 55.3° or NE .
  • Szeged has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Balmaceda Puerto has a dry-summer maritime subalpine climate (Csc).
  • Szeged is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Balmaceda Puerto is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 4.1 °C (7.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.9 °C (19.6°F) more in Szeged.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 116.6 mm (4.6 in) less which is equivalent to 116.6 l/m² (2.86 US gal/ft²) or 1,166,000 l/ha (124,653 US gal/ac) less. About 4/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.4° higher in Szeged than in Balmaceda Puerto.
  • Relative humidity levels are 4.2%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 4.7°C (8.4°F) higher.
